什么是区块链钱包地址?
在理解区块链钱包地址之前,我们首先需要明确“区块链”与“钱包”这两个概念。区块链是一种去中心化的分布式账本技术,它记录着所有的交易。当你想要与其他人进行加密货币的转账时,钱包地址便是你在区块链中的身份标识。
区块链钱包地址是由一串字符组成的,通常是数字与字母的组合。这些字符不仅是你在网络中进行交易的“收款码”,同时也与隐私和安全性密切相关。那么,这些复杂的字符是如何构成的呢?
钱包地址的基本构成

基本上,区块链钱包地址由两部分组成:前缀和地址本体。前缀标识了地址的类型和网络。例如,比特币的地址以"1"或"3"开头,以太坊的地址以"0x"开头。这些前缀不仅便于识别不同的网络,同时也在一定程度上增强了安全性。
而地址本体则是根据特定的算法生成的一串字符。以比特币地址为例,通常是通过SHA-256和RIPEMD-160等加密算法将公钥处理后形成的。两个不同的公钥不可能产生相同的钱包地址,这一特性大大增强了使用这些钱包地址进行交易时的安全性。
地址的生成过程
钱包地址的生成过程虽然复杂,但这个过程并非完全不可理解。首先,用户需要生成一个密钥对,这包括一个私钥和一个公钥。私钥是用户的“秘密”,必须妥善保存,而公钥可以公开共享。
接着,生成钱包地址的过程包括几个步骤: 1. 从随机数生成私钥。 2. 利用私钥生成公钥。 3. 应用Hash算法对公钥进行处理,生成地址。 4. 添加网络前缀,最后得到完整的地址。
以比特币为例,我们可以看到,经过一系列的SHA-256和RIPEMD-160算法处理后,最终的比特币地址可以借助Base58编码进一步简化。这样做不仅降低了用户输入时出错的概率,同时也让地址更为便于分享。
影响钱包地址安全性的因素

钱包地址的安全性关乎到用户的资产安全,不可小觑。私钥的保护是确保该地址安全的关键。如果私钥被他人获取,任何人都能通过该地址进行转账操作。因此,用户在选择如何存储私钥时需要谨慎,例如选择硬件钱包来减少黑客攻击的风险。
此外,地址的复杂性也是影响安全性的重要因素。简单或短的地址容易被猜测,增加了被攻击的风险。因此,选择强密码与复杂的地址变得尤其重要。当你看到长度相对较长且字符多样的地址时,实际上这是一种安全性较高的表现。
如何验证钱包地址的有效性
在进行加密货币交易时,确保输入的钱包地址的有效性是至关重要的。许多区块链系统都提供了地址的校验机制,避免用户错误输入。对于比特币而言,地址由26到35个字符组成,且可通过在地址结尾处加上校验和来确认。
校验和是一种确保输入地址无误的机制,通过简单的数学运算,可以检查地址是否符合区块链的格式。如果地址的长度不符合或校验和不正确,则很可能是输入错误。这种机制减少了潜在的资金损失风险。对于一般用户来说,在进行转账前一定要再次核对地址是非常重要的。
个人经验分享:安全存储与互操作性
在我的加密货币投资过程中,我逐渐认识到钱包地址与私钥管理的重要性。有一次,由于私钥未妥善保管,导致我资金无法找回,那次经验让我明白了安全存储的重要性。我选择了硬件钱包,并设置了复杂的密码,以防范恶意攻击。
在选择钱包时,还要考虑互操作性的问题。有些钱包只支持特定类型的加密货币,而大部分用户在交易时可能需要多种币种。因此,在选择钱包时最好选择那些支持多种资产的钱包。同时,定期备份钱包地址和私钥也是防范意外的重要手段。
区块链发展趋势与钱包地址的未来
区块链技术仍在不断发展,钱包地址的构成和安全性也可能会随之改变。随着技术的进步,越来越多的公司致力于提升钱包的安全性和用户体验。例如,去中心化钱包(DeFi)正在兴起,用户不仅可以用来存储资产,还能利用其进行借贷和收益。这样的变化使得传统钱包地址面临挑战,特别是在安全性和易用性之间取得平衡时。
随着量子计算的进步,未来的密码学也可能会对钱包地址的结构产生影响。虽然目前尚处于远期,但这一可能性无疑给整个加密货币生态带来了新的挑战与机遇。
结语:关注钱包地址的安全与发展
无论你是加密货币的使用者,还是对其感兴趣的观察者,理解钱包地址的组成与安全性都至关重要。保护私钥、验证地址有效性,以及关注区块链技术的发展方向,不仅能够帮助我们更好地进行加密货币交易,也让我们在未来可能面临的新技术挑战中,不至于束手无策。
随着区块链技术的不断发展,钱包的安全与易用性也在逐步提升。了解这些知识,可以让你在这个不断变化的领域中走得更远。希望每个加密货币的使用者都能珍惜和保护好自己的资产。